[QUOTE="j13501, post: 303513, member: 918"] Perhaps you need to remember that "THOSE KIND OF PEOPLE" are the ones that generate our paychecks. You may not like the answer, but I hope you see that UPS can't run a business where each driver decides for him/herself who is the rude customer that it's OK to be rude to in return. Drivers are expected to be professional, and the vast majority are excellent every day. All jobs at UPS are challenging- they have there good and bad points. One bad point for a driver is rude customers. Since we're in a service business, I would suggest that you take the advice of "the ones giving that advice(who) NEVER DID THIS JOB". You may not respect them, but when dealing with difficult customers, it is best to just say hello, get the signature and say goodbye. Take the time to talk to a senior driver who never seems to have any issues with management, the other drivers or his/her customers. I hope you'll hear some advice that helps you deal better with customers. It could just save your job. Good Luck [/QUOTE]
